1407. Mrs S V Kalyan (DA) to ask the Minister of Water and Environmental
Affairs:
(1) (a) When is the work on the raising of the Clanwilliam Dam (i)
scheduled to commence and (ii) due for completion and (b) how
much money has been allocated to this project;
(2) whether these funds are sufficient to see the project through to
completion; if not, why not; if so, what are the relevant
details;
(3) whether the values of the properties on the Nooitgedacht Nature
Reserve that are affected by the project and that are expected
to be purchased by her department have been determined; if not,
why not; if so, (a) when is it envisaged that these properties
will be purchased by her department and (b) what are the
further relevant details;
(4) whether her department is in communication with the owners of
these properties regarding the status of the project and its
timelines; if not, why not; if so, what are the relevant
details?
NW1575E
---00O00---
REPLY:
(1)(a)(i) The tender design for the raising of the dam is currently in
progress. Site establishment for the construction of the dam is
scheduled to commence in April 2012.
(1)(a)(ii) Depending on funding availability the target date for
completion is May 2016.
(1)(b) The Departmental budget provides for an expenditure of
R333.2 million on the project for the three financial years
from 2011/12 to 2013/14. The allocation for 2011/12 is R9.6
million.
(2) No. Further funding will be required as the total cost of the
project is estimated R1 6 billion and in addition funding would
be required for the conveyance system to distribute the water
from the raised dam to resource poor farmers and to assist in
their establishment. The latter costing still has to be done
and for that purpose a joint study is shortly to be undertaken
by the Department in conjunction with the Western Cape
Department of Agriculture.
(3)(a) No. The values of the properties affected can only be
determined after the high flood line has been finalised. The
latter depends on the design of the dam wall and spillway which
is still at a preliminary stage.
(3)(b) After the spillway design is complete and the high flood
level finalised, the drawings showing the new dam boundary line
and schedules of the additional area required can be prepared.
The independent professional valuator, already appointed, will
then use this information to determine compensation for each
affected property after discussions with each individual
landowner.

(4) Yes. The affected landowners were informed about the project,
and the procedures to be followed, at a meeting in Clanwilliam
after receipt of the Record of Decision in 2009. As soon as
there is further information relevant to the acquisition of
properties (as referred to in (3) above) there will be further
communication and engagement with the affected landowners of
progress to inform them of progress.
